ChatGPT Reasoning
Vendor version: o3 (as of 29 August 2026)
OpenAI's line designed for multi-step inference works through a chain of derivation before answering. That pays off where the order of the checking steps matters - holding sets of clauses against each other, breaking facts down onto statutory elements, searching for contradictions in documents - but costs considerably more response time than the standard tiers. The line is procured via Azure, and on that route the contractual chain is closed: the confidentiality undertaking is signed and covers the models sold by Azure. Processing stays inside the EU, storage at rest in the chosen Azure geography.

What it is good for
- Multi-step inference with an internal chain of derivation - stronger on orders of examination than the standard class
- Four tiers in the EU, two of them additionally as a regional deployment in Sweden
- Same contractual line as the other models sold by Azure
Where it stops
- Considerably longer response times and higher cost than the standard class - unsuitable for bulk tasks
- The internal chain of derivation is not an audit report: case-law citations and references still have to be verified professionally
- Abuse monitoring is active by default; switching it off depends on a vendor approval that cannot be booked directly
Routes examined
The same model, procured differently, is a different legal position. What is examined per route is the contract chain, not the model.
